Transaction 09d96981f3224d05160d1f6cd3efdde1bed0f52357228137fc393acc899814eb
1 Input
1 Output
-
09d96981f3224d05160d1f6cd3efdde1bed0f52357228137fc393acc899814eb:0
- value
- 17280221
- script pubkey
- OP_0 OP_PUSHBYTES_20 9028cc99f4cab7811d8ffaa5e6c59bde58f46406
- address
- bc1qjq5vex05e2mcz8v0l2j7d3vmmev0geqx4t658a